Output 9659a617386e7e1fd9370ed0a76854e15b7ad6495e186f16dada2a15176435db:0

value
12821253
script pubkey
OP_0 OP_PUSHBYTES_20 052663845460c29a32acbd032110b4c0563dd1ef
address
bc1qq5nx8pz5vrpf5v4vh5pjzy95cptrm500zs2yy3
transaction
9659a617386e7e1fd9370ed0a76854e15b7ad6495e186f16dada2a15176435db
confirmations
78046
spent
true